Why Windsor Hills gets mentioned more is as you said because it's newer, has a zero entry huge pool with waterslide, along with the mini movie theatre and other amenities that are especially good for those in the condos and townhouses. When we stay in a pool home, like you, we never use the clubhouse pool at all.
Emerald Island used to be the one to stay at before Windsor Hills. It has lots of landscaping and greenery and a great looking entry area. We like both subdivisions equally. :thumbsup2

There's a SuperWalmart on 535 on the way from the airport and just down the road on the corner of 192 there's a Publix Supermarket. I don't know about the wine and beer at Walmart but I think Publix has. There are lots of Publix stores in the area and this would have the biggest variety. Emerald Island also has a Tiki Bar by the pool at the clubhouse. It has drinks and a few menu items available. There's also a few activities going on at the clubhouse so check in there and get a schedule. Hope you have a great time.
 
This is some info on the shuttle service.

Main Gate Transportation
Taxi Service
407-390-0000 ext.3
cost per person round trip to Disney $11.00, To Universal is $15.00PP
depart EIR 9:35, 11:55 to Disney
return EIR 5:00, 8:00, 10:15
depart EIR 8:25 10:50 to Universal
return EIR 5:15, 7:15
return EIR 5:00, 8:00, 10:15

Please ask about times they change every month.

I don't know how many of you there are, but you may be able to organize a private shuttle for your family group for less than paying for the individual shuttle tickets. Contact Maingate Transportation and ask. They should then also be able to pick you up at the home rather than at the clubhouse.

Also groceries, there are companies that will deliver groceries to you. GardenGrocer.com is one and WeGoShop.com is another.
